Chandigarh – The City Beautiful is a marvel planned and designed by Swiss-French architect Le Corbusier and American Architect Albert Mayer.

Post independence Chandigarh is one of the earliest planned cities and is internationally known for its architecture and modern design

The city covers an area of around 114 square kilometres and is at an altitude of 1054 Ft from sea level. Chandigarh is Divided in 56 sector

The city is having one of the highest per capita incomes in the country. Chandigarh is one of the few master-planned cities in the world

Covered by dense plantations and Trees of banyan, eucalyptus, ashoka, mulberry, cassia and many others. Chandigarh offers a perfect balance of nature and modern lifestyle.

Chandigarh has grown very fast since its initial construction. It has also impacted the development of nearby cities of Mohali and Panchkula.
